Using bleach to clear clogged drains. When unclogging a bathtub with bleach, first get all of the water out of the tub by either waiting until it has drained or by removing the water with a cup or bowl. Once the snake moves freely, unlock it, and manually feed more wire into the drain until it stops again.Q: What is the best way to remove hair from a clogged bathtub drain? A: One of the most common causes of a clogged bathtub drain is hair. To remove hair from a clogged drain, try using a drain snake or a wire hanger with a small hook on the end. Insert the tool into the drain and gently pull out any hair or debris that is causing the blockage.

About Press Copyright Contact us Creators Advertise Developers Terms Privacy Policy & Safety How YouTube works Test new features NFL Sunday Ticket Press Copyright ...How to prevent a clogged tub drain: Use a drain cover to catch hair before it enters the drain. Regularly clean drains with a mix of baking soda, vinegar and hot water. Also, choose larger tub toys that cannot fit in the drain.
